Speeds of sound and isentropic compressibilities of (n-heptanol plus n-pentane, or n-hexane, or n-heptane, or n-octane) at T=303.15 K, and of (n-heptanol+2,2,4-trimethylpentane) at T=293.15 and 303.15 K

摘要

Speeds of sound u have been measured in binary liquid mixtures of n-heptanol (n-C7H15OH) and n-pentane (n-C5H12), or n-hexane (n-C6H14), or n-heptane (n-C7H16), or n-octane (n-C8H18) at T = 303.15 K and in binary liquid mixtures of n-heptanol and 2,2,4-trimethylpentane (2,2,4-(CH3)(3)C5H9) at T = 293.15 and 303.15 K. The values of u have been used to calculate the apparent excess speeds of sound Deltau and the isentropic compressibilities K-S for these mixtures. The excess isentropic compressibilities K-S(E) have also been calculated from the values of K-S. The K-S(E) property has been found to be negative throughout the entire composition range for {x n-C7H15OH + (1 - x)n-C5H12}, {x n-C7H15OH + (1 - x)n-C6H14}, {x n-C7H15OH + (1 - x)n-C7H16}, and {x n-C7H15OH + (1 - x)2,2,4-(CH3)(3)C5H9}. For {x n-C7H15OH + (1 - x)n-C8H18, the K-S(E) has been found to be positive at very low mole fractions of n-C7H15OH, and negative at other mole fractions. The values of Deltau and K-S(E) have been fitted to representative equations. (C) 2000 Elsevier Science B.V. All rights reserved. [References: 18]
